Common HVAC Emergencies That Require Immediate Attention

A number of HVAC problems require emergency service. Recognizing these problems can help you understand when to call for professional assistance:

  • Complete System Failure
    When your heating or cooling system quits working completely, particularly during severe weather, it's more than simply an inconvenience-- it can be hazardous. Our emergency HVAC specialists can diagnose and repair the issue immediately, restoring your home's convenience and safety.
  • Uncommon Noises or Smells
    Unusual seem like banging, grinding, or screeching from your HVAC system frequently signal a major mechanical problem that might result in bigger problems if not attended to rapidly. Similarly, uncommon smells might show electrical problems or even gas leakages. Our professional HVAC professionals can determine these issues and make necessary repair work before they become dangerous.
  • Water Leaks
    Water leaking from your HVAC system can harm your home and lead to mold development. Our professionals find the source of leaks and fix them appropriately to prevent water damage.
  • Refrigerant Leaks
    Refrigerant leaks decrease your air conditioning system's cooling capability and can harm the environment. They require professional attention as refrigerant handling calls for specialized training and devices.
  • Electrical Issues
    Problems with electrical components in your HVAC system position fire threats and ought to be resolved instantly by certified professionals. Our HVAC contractors have the training to safely repair electrical issues.

Common HVAC Problems Homeowners Face

  • Poor Airflow
    Limited air flow makes your system work more difficult and lowers comfort. Our HVAC specialists recognize air flow problems, whether triggered by duct problems, unclean filters, or fan problems.
  • Uneven Heating or Cooling
    If some spaces are too hot while others are too cold, you might have duct issues, insulation problems, or an improperly sized system. Our professional HVAC specialists can diagnose these issues and recommend solutions.
  • Brief Cycling
    When your system switches on and off frequently, it squanders energy and wears out components quicker. Our HVAC professionals can figure out whether the issue originates from a stopped up filter, inappropriate thermostat settings, or something more serious.
  • High Energy Bills
    Abrupt boosts in energy costs typically suggest HVAC inadequacy. Our contractors perform energy performance assessments to recognize the cause and recommend enhancements.
  • Humidity Problems
    Modern HVAC systems ought to assist manage indoor humidity. If your home feels too humid in summer season or too dry in winter, our HVAC professionals can advise options to enhance convenience and air quality.
  • Thermostat Problems
    Sometimes what seems like a system failure is in fact a thermostat issue. Our HVAC contractors can repair or replace thermostats and help you upgrade to programmable or smart designs for much better convenience control and energy savings.

Preparing for HVAC Emergencies

  • Keep Contact Information Handy
    Store our emergency number 888-409-7841 in your phone so you can reach us rapidly when required.
  • Know Your System Basics
    Familiarize yourself with the area of your HVAC equipment and how to shut it off in case of emergency.
  • Perform Regular Maintenance
    Routine professional upkeep reduces the likelihood of emergency situations. Our HVAC professionals can develop a upkeep schedule for your system.
  • Install Carbon Monoxide Detectors
    If you have combustion heating devices, carbon monoxide gas detectors provide an early caution of dangerous leaks.
